The Three Standard Flood Insurance Policy Forms
The NFIP Standard Flood Insurance Policy has three main policy forms. Use the policy form that matches the insured property type. These links open the official FEMA PDFs.
Dwelling Form
Generally used for 1-4 family residential buildings, individual residential condominium units, certain residential contents claims, and similar dwelling risks.
Open Dwelling SFIPGeneral Property Form
Generally used for non-residential buildings, commercial risks, and 5-or-more family residential buildings.
Open General Property SFIPRCBAP Form
Used for eligible residential condominium association buildings insured under a Residential Condominium Building Association Policy.
